That difference becomes more noticeable in slots, where two games with similar graphics may use completely different mathematics. BingoPlus educational material discusses RTP, volatility, hit frequency, symbols, and bonus features. RTP is a theoretical long-run percentage, not the amount a player receives during a short session. A hypothetical game with 96% RTP is designed around an average return of 96 units for every 100 wagered over a very large number of plays; one player can finish far above or below that figure. BingoPlus also notes that two games with the same 96% RTP can distribute results very differently when their volatility differs.
That statistical distinction matters when users move from slots to casino games. Casino sections can include table-based or live formats where the screen may show betting controls, game history, timers, rules, and streamed play together. Live presentation can make a session easier to follow, but video does not alter the probability structure of the game. A dealer feed, animated result board, or recent-results panel should not be read as a forecast of the next result, which is why understanding the rules remains more useful than studying short streaks.

Sports access extends the account beyond casino-style games. The official sports area remains part of the platform in 2026 and carries the same over-21 restriction. Sports betting can involve markets whose settlement rules differ by sport, event, and bet type, so checking whether overtime, cancellations, postponements, or specific statistics count is important before confirming a wager. Rewards and promotions also should not be confused with a game’s mathematical return. A 30% promotional figure, for example, describes an offer under its stated conditions; it does not turn a game with a published RTP into a game with an RTP that is 30 percentage points higher. The same distinction applies to cashback, rebates, free-play credits, or event prizes. Each has separate terms, while the game itself continues to operate under its own rules and probability model.

Responsible-gaming tools matter most when session length or spending starts moving beyond a user’s planned amount. Setting a fixed spending limit before opening a game is easier to measure than deciding after several rounds. A player with a ₱1,000 entertainment budget, for example, can define that amount before play rather than increasing it after losses. The same approach applies to time: a planned 60-minute session provides a clear stopping point, while repeated extensions can turn a short activity into several hours.
Game information can support those limits because pace differs widely across the catalogue. Bingo rounds, slots, poker hands, casino tables, and sports markets do not operate at the same speed. Faster play can produce more wagering events within 30 minutes even when the amount placed on each round looks small. Checking stake size together with play frequency gives a clearer view of total spending than looking only at the price of one round.
